Battery Precautions
Handling
� � � � � � � � � �
Never put the battery pack in a fire, as it could explode and cause injury. Do not attempt to open or alter the battery pack. Do not place the battery where it might get hotter than 60°C (140°F). Do not allow metal objects such as jewelry to short across the battery terminals, as it could heat up and explode. The battery includes a circuit breaker to help protect against short circuiting. However, covering or pressing this breaker switch hard could cause the battery to malfunction. Do not allow liquids to come in contact with the battery pack. Avoid dropping the pack, or other violent shock. Do not solder to the battery terminals.
3
Charging Charge the battery pack only with the notebook�s built-in AC adapter.
Discharging Do not use the battery pack for any purpose other than powering the notebook computer.
Storage
� �
Store the battery pack in a cool and dry place. Never allow the temperature to exceed 60°C (140°F) during storage. Recharge the battery pack after storage, before use.
